使用 C 程序操作 Excel 文件的完整指南
使用 C 程序從頭創(chuàng)建 Excel 文件 創(chuàng)建 Excel 應(yīng)用程序?qū)ο笫紫刃枰獎(jiǎng)?chuàng)建一個(gè) Excel 應(yīng)用程序?qū)ο笞鳛椴僮魅肟???梢允褂靡韵麓a實(shí)現(xiàn):```csharp xApp new ();`
使用 C 程序從頭創(chuàng)建 Excel 文件
創(chuàng)建 Excel 應(yīng)用程序?qū)ο?/p>
首先需要?jiǎng)?chuàng)建一個(gè) Excel 應(yīng)用程序?qū)ο笞鳛椴僮魅肟???梢允褂靡韵麓a實(shí)現(xiàn):
```csharp
xApp new ();
```
新建 Excel 工作簿
創(chuàng)建好 Excel 應(yīng)用程序?qū)ο蠛?,接下來可以新建一個(gè) Excel 工作簿:
```csharp
xBook ();
```
選擇工作表
創(chuàng)建工作簿后,需要選擇要操作的具體工作表:
```csharp
xSheet ()[1];
```
向 Excel 中寫入數(shù)據(jù)
有了工作簿和工作表的引用后,就可以向 Excel 中寫入數(shù)據(jù)了。例如:
```csharp
xSheet.Cells[1, 1] "姓名";
xSheet.Cells[1, 2] "年齡";
xSheet.Cells[2, 1] "張三";
xSheet.Cells[2, 2] 25;
```
保存 Excel 文件
最后一步是保存 Excel 文件:
```csharp
("D:test.xlsx");
```
使用 C 程序打開并操作現(xiàn)有 Excel 文件
打開已有的 Excel 文件
如果需要打開一個(gè)已有的 Excel 文件進(jìn)行操作,可以使用以下代碼:
```csharp
xBook ("D:test.xlsx");
```
選擇工作表
選擇要操作的工作表的方式與新建 Excel 文件時(shí)相同:
```csharp
xSheet ()[1];
```
從 Excel 中讀取數(shù)據(jù)
使用以下方式從 Excel 中讀取數(shù)據(jù):
```csharp
string name (string)xSheet.Cells[2, 1].Value2;
int age (int)xSheet.Cells[2, 2].Value2;
```
保存并關(guān)閉 Excel 文件
操作完成后,需要保存文件并釋放 Excel 對(duì)象占用的資源:
```csharp
();
();
xApp.Quit();
```
綜上所述,使用 C 程序操作 Excel 文件包括創(chuàng)建 Excel 應(yīng)用程序?qū)ο?、打開或新建 Excel 工作簿、選擇工作表、讀寫數(shù)據(jù),最后保存并關(guān)閉文件。希望這個(gè)指南對(duì)您有所幫助。